What does a general store manager do?

They’re the folks who manage the general operations of the store , making sure it runs smoothly and meets budget and sales goals. A store manager plans employee schedules, interviews, hires, coordinates and disciplines employees when necessary. They make sure the store is well-stocked, clean and in proper working order.

How much money does a store manager at Dollar General make?

Average Dollar General Store Manager yearly pay in the United States is approximately $34,383 , which is 24% below the national average.

How much does a district manager make at Dollar General?

How much does a District Manager make at Dollar General in the United States? Average Dollar General District Manager yearly pay in the United States is approximately $72,682 , which is 11% above the national average.

Can you be a store manager without a degree?

Formal qualifications are not required to work as a Retail Store Manager, as this is usually a position that is obtained through work experience and on-the-job training. However, qualifications in retail services may be viewed favourably by employers.

Do you need a degree to be a store manager?

Even though most store managers have a college degree , it’s possible to become one with only a high school degree or GED. ... You may find that experience in other jobs will help you become a store manager. In fact, many store manager jobs require experience in a role such as assistant manager.

What are the five key responsibilities of a manager?

At the most fundamental level, management is a discipline that consists of a set of five general functions: planning, organizing, staffing, leading and controlling . These five functions are part of a body of practices and theories on how to be a successful manager.
